💡 Let's remember some important tips to keep ourselves safe:

1️⃣ Follow your gut: If something seems suspicious or uncomfortable, avoid it and get to a safe place.

2️⃣ Stay up to date: Always share your nightly route with someone you trust, and use your cell phone as a tool to stay connected. Feel free to talk on the phone on the way home with a loved one.

3️⃣ Listen and observe: Pay attention to your surroundings. Our ears can be just as important as our eyes when it comes to spotting potential hazards.

4️⃣ Get a companion: If possible, walk with someone when moving around at night. It provides an extra layer of security.

5️⃣ Have the emergency number ready: Always have your emergency number available and ready to use. Safety comes first!
